Dating Confidence Reset
If you’re tired of feeling invisible, burned out, or unsure what you want, start small and practical. Decide what you want from dating right now—casual chats, a few coffees, or someone to see more seriously—and write it down. A clear, simple goal makes every choice easier.
Set Realistic Expectations
Expect a mix of outcomes: some conversations will click, others won’t. That’s normal. Treat each interaction as information, not a verdict on your worth. Limit how much time you spend swiping or refreshing messages—quality over quantity helps you stay steady.
Pace Conversations Intentionally
- Open with a focused message that invites a response, and give people a day or two to reply before deciding to move on.
- Aim for a few meaningful exchanges before swapping numbers or meeting in person; this reduces awkward drops and saves emotional energy.
- Match your responsiveness to your comfort level—there’s no required tempo.
Choose Matches Thoughtfully
Scan profiles for two clear signs of compatibility (values, interests, or lifestyle). Prioritize those over a long list of minor preferences. If a profile consistently contradicts your deal-breakers, it’s fine to skip it without over-analyzing.
Notice Progress, Not Perfection
Keep a simple log of wins: a good first message, a relaxed video chat, or a polite way you ended a conversation. These small steps add up and remind you that you’re improving, even when results are slow.
Protect Your Energy
Set limits: a daily time cap, clear boundaries about late-night texting, and an exit line you can use when conversations drain you. If rejection stings, pause for a short reset—do something that restores you, then come back with a fresh mindset.
